Comprehensive Overview: TMBill vs Xilnex

TMBill and Xilnex are both technologies aimed at providing solutions primarily for the hospitality and retail sectors, specifically focusing on point-of-sale (POS) systems and enterprise resource planning (ERP). Below is a detailed overview of their primary functions, target markets, market share, user base, and key differentiating factors:

a) Primary Functions and Target Markets

TMBill:

  • Primary Functions: TMBill offers cloud-based POS solutions tailored for the hospitality industry, which includes restaurants, cafes, hotels, and bars. Its core functions include order management, billing, inventory management, customer relationship management (CRM), and real-time analytics. It also integrates with online food delivery platforms, providing a comprehensive solution for managing dine-in as well as takeaway and delivery orders.
  • Target Markets: The primary market for TMBill is the food and beverage (F&B) industry, covering small to medium-sized enterprises (SMEs) and larger chains in the hospitality sector.

Xilnex:

  • Primary Functions: Xilnex provides an all-in-one cloud-based POS and ERP system. It goes beyond just POS with features such as comprehensive inventory management, CRM, sales reporting, and employee management. The system is designed to support operations in both the retail and hospitality sectors with its omnichannel capabilities, integrating in-store and online sales channels.
  • Target Markets: Xilnex targets a wide range of businesses within the retail and hospitality industries, from small businesses to large enterprise-level clients. This includes retail stores, restaurants, franchises, and other service providers looking for a unified system to manage operations.

b) Market Share and User Base

Quantifying the exact market share and user base for TMBill vs. Xilnex can be complex due to the lack of precise public data on these specifics. However, both systems have established themselves within their respective niches:

  • TMBill: TMBill is predominantly used in India and some regions in Southeast Asia. Its focus on the F&B industry limits its market scope compared to Xilnex but gives it a strong hold in specific geographies and segments. It is particularly popular among SMEs due to its cost-effectiveness and specialized features for the foodservice industry.

  • Xilnex: Xilnex has a broader international presence, operating in multiple countries across Asia, the Middle East, and even some Western markets. Its more extensive feature set and suitability for both retail and hospitality provide it with a larger overall market share and a more diverse user base. Enterprise clients and larger chains are more likely to lean towards Xilnex for its scalability and integration capabilities.

c) Key Differentiating Factors

TMBill:

  1. Specialization in F&B: TMBill's strength is its specialization in the hospitality sector, which can lead to better support and more refined features for F&B businesses compared to more generalized systems.
  2. Integration with Food Delivery Platforms: It provides seamless integration with local and international food delivery services, enhancing its appeal to restaurants heavily reliant on delivery.
  3. Cost-Effectiveness: Typically offers more competitive pricing structures, which is attractive to smaller businesses with budget constraints.

Xilnex:

  1. Broader Functionality: Xilnex offers a wider range of features that encompass both retail and hospitality needs, making it suitable for businesses that need a more comprehensive solution.
  2. Scalability: The platform is designed to support businesses of all sizes, which is attractive for companies planning to scale operations or those with complex needs.
  3. Omnichannel Capabilities: Its ability to integrate various sales channels (online and offline) gives it a strong edge in managing modern retail and hospitality environments.

In conclusion, while both TMBill and Xilnex provide robust solutions for their respective markets, their differences in specialization, scalability, and feature offerings make them suitable for different types of businesses within the retail and hospitality sectors. Businesses choosing between the two would need to assess their specific needs, budget, and future growth plans.

Feature Similarity Breakdown: TMBill, Xilnex

Here's a feature similarity breakdown for TMBill and Xilnex:

a) Core Features in Common

  1. Point of Sale (POS) Capabilities: Both TMBill and Xilnex offer comprehensive POS systems that can handle billing, sales transactions, and receipt generation.
  2. Inventory Management: Both platforms provide tools for tracking and managing inventory, including stock levels, purchase orders, and supplier information.
  3. Customer Relationship Management (CRM): Basic CRM functionalities, such as customer data storage and loyalty programs, are present in both systems.
  4. Reporting and Analytics: Users can access sales reports, performance metrics, and other analytical tools to monitor business activities with both solutions.
  5. Integration Features: Both solutions support integrations with various third-party applications, including accounting software and payment gateways.
  6. Cloud-based Solutions: Both TMBill and Xilnex offer cloud-based solutions, allowing businesses to access their systems from anywhere with an internet connection.

b) User Interface Comparison

  • TMBill: TMBill's interface is often described as user-friendly and intuitive, making it easier for new users to navigate the system. The design prioritizes simplicity, which benefits small businesses and restaurants looking for straightforward solutions.
  • Xilnex: Xilnex tends to have a more sophisticated and feature-rich interface, which can be both a strength and a challenge. The interface is designed to cater to a wider range of business models, which may require more time for training and adaptation for users unfamiliar with complex systems.

c) Unique Features

  • TMBill:

    • Focus on Simplified Operations: TMBill emphasizes streamlined operations specifically tailored for the F&B sector, offering features like table management and order-ahead facilities.
    • Mobile Accessibility: TMBill provides a robust mobile app that enhances accessibility and usability on the go, which is particularly advantageous for small businesses that might not have extensive IT infrastructure.
  • Xilnex:

    • Advanced Customization Options: Xilnex offers more extensive customization options, allowing businesses to tailor the system to specific needs across various industries beyond just F&B.
    • Comprehensive Multi-Outlet Management: Xilnex excels in managing multiple locations and outlets, offering centralized control and data synchronization.
    • Broader Industry Applications: The software's ability to cater to multiple industries, including retail, services, and hospitality, makes it versatile for different business needs.

Both TMBill and Xilnex are strong POS systems, each with its own strengths. The choice between them would largely depend on the specific needs and scale of the business, as well as user preferences for features and interface design.

Best Fit Use Cases: TMBill, Xilnex

Certainly! Here's a breakdown of the best fit use cases for TMBill and Xilnex:

TMBill

a) For What Types of Businesses or Projects is TMBill the Best Choice?

  • Restaurants and Cafes: TMBill is specifically designed for the food and beverage industry, making it a perfect choice for restaurants, cafes, and food chains. It supports quick service, table service, and delivery management.

  • Bars and Pubs: The software is well-suited for bars and pubs due to its features like inventory management, billing, and real-time reporting which are crucial for businesses with fast-paced sales environments.

  • Franchise Management: TMBill is beneficial for franchise businesses in the F&B sector as it offers centralized management across multiple outlets. It helps maintain consistency in operations and sales tracking across locations.

  • Cloud Kitchen Operations: Its cloud-based solution makes it ideal for cloud kitchen setups, offering seamless order management and integration with various delivery partners.

How TMBill Caters to Different Industry Verticals or Company Sizes

  • Small and Medium-Sized Enterprises (SMEs): TMBill is a scalable solution that fits small to medium-sized enterprises due to its cost-effectiveness and ease of deployment.
  • Enterprise Chains: The platform also supports larger chains with multiple locations, providing centralized control and analytics for strategic decision-making across outlets.

Xilnex

b) In What Scenarios Would Xilnex be the Preferred Option?

  • Retail and Wholesale: Xilnex is versatile and caters effectively to both retail and wholesale businesses. It provides comprehensive point-of-sale (POS) functionalities tailored for complex inventory and customer relationship management (CRM).

  • Multi-Channel Sales: Businesses engaging in both online and offline sales benefit from Xilnex's ability to integrate various sales channels and provide a unified view of operations.

  • Fashion and Apparel Stores: The software is particularly strong in the fashion retail space, with features that support size and color management, seasonal inventory tracking, and sophisticated customer loyalty programs.

  • Specialty and Department Stores: Xilnex supports customization for various product types and categories, making it suitable for specialty stores and larger department stores that offer diverse product lines.

How Xilnex Caters to Different Industry Verticals or Company Sizes

  • Large Enterprises: Xilnex is able to support enterprise-level operations with extensive customization and integration capabilities, making it suitable for larger businesses with robust operational requirements.

  • SMEs and Growing Businesses: The modular nature allows small to medium businesses to adopt a cost-effective solution that can grow with them, adding more features as their needs evolve.

Conclusion

While TMBill focuses on serving the food and beverage sector with its streamlined solutions for restaurants, bars, and franchises, Xilnex offers broader applications in retail and multi-channel scenarios, supporting both SMEs and larger enterprises. The choice between the two would depend on the specific industry needs, business size, and the complexity of operations.

Conclusion & Final Verdict: TMBill vs Xilnex

To provide a comprehensive conclusion and final verdict for TMBill and Xilnex, I'll analyze each product in terms of their overall value, pros and cons, and offer specific recommendations for potential users.

a) Best Overall Value

TMBill: TMBill is generally more accessible for small to medium-sized businesses due to its competitive pricing and user-friendly interface. It offers essential features like billing, inventory management, and customer relationship management, making it a solid choice for businesses that require a straightforward yet efficient point-of-sale (POS) solution.

Xilnex: Xilnex tends to cater to a broader range of business sizes, including larger enterprises. It is known for its robust, feature-rich offerings, including advanced analytics, extensive customization options, and support for multiple outlets and countries. While it may be priced higher, the comprehensive nature of its features could provide more value to businesses that need a scalable and flexible solution.

Conclusion: Considering all factors, TMBill offers the best overall value for small to medium-sized enterprises that prioritize budget and ease of use. Xilnex, on the other hand, provides more value for larger businesses or those with complex requirements due to its extensive feature set.

b) Pros and Cons

TMBill:

  • Pros:
    • Cost-effective solution for small businesses
    • Easy to set up and use, with an intuitive interface
    • Basic features cover essential business needs
    • Quick customer support and regular updates
  • Cons:
    • Limited advanced features for large enterprises
    • May lack the depth needed for highly specialized industries or operations
    • Scalability could be an issue for expanding businesses

Xilnex:

  • Pros:
    • Extensive and diverse feature set suitable for large enterprises
    • High degree of customization possible
    • Strong analytics and reporting capabilities
    • Support for multi-outlet businesses and international operations
  • Cons:
    • Higher cost, which can be prohibitive for smaller businesses
    • Steeper learning curve due to feature complexity
    • Implementation may require more time and tech expertise

c) Recommendations for Users

  1. Identify Your Business Size and Needs: Small businesses with straightforward requirements might gravitate towards TMBill, while larger businesses or those with intricate needs might prefer Xilnex.

  2. Budget Considerations: If budget is a primary concern, consider TMBill for its cost-effectiveness. If your business can invest more into a comprehensive system, Xilnex might be a better fit.

  3. Expansion Plans: Consider where you see your business in the next few years. For plans involving significant expansion or international branches, Xilnex could offer the scalability that TMBill might not.

  4. Trial and Support: Test both systems via trial versions if available. Evaluate customer support services, as the ability to resolve issues quickly and effectively could be a deciding factor.

  5. Feedback and Reviews: Seek user testimonials and case studies from businesses similar to yours that have implemented these systems. Real-world feedback can provide insights beyond what feature lists can convey.

Ultimately, the decision between TMBill and Xilnex should be made by assessing specific business goals, technological requirements, and financial capacity. Both systems have distinct advantages, and aligning them with your operational needs will maximize value.
